description Introduction and Objective: This research explores the use of drone technology to enhance safety, route planning efficiency, and psychological comfort in extreme sports, with a focus on rock climbing. The objective is to determine how drones can contribute to performance improvements in these areas. Methodology: Employing a mixed-methods approach, the study assesses the impact of drone surveillance on key performance indicators, including emergency response times, route planning accuracy, and athlete confidence. Results: Findings indicate that drones significantly reduce emergency response times by enabling quicker hazard identification and navigation, thereby improving overall safety. Drone-assisted route planning also proves to be more efficient and accurate, facilitating better decision-making in complex terrains. Furthermore, drones enhance athletes' psychological comfort, leading to increased confidence and security during high-risk activities. Conclusions: Despite the advantages, challenges such as technological dependency and potential drone malfunctions in extreme environments are acknowledged. Future research should investigate the reliability of drones under diverse conditions and explore further applications in sports. The study advocates for the broader adoption of drones, highlighting their potential to significantly improve safety protocols, training strategies, and athlete well-being in extreme sports.
